Address 95.21682629 DCR

DsmaFakf4QRxwzPSuhKdrV9vzw8VbjaScmV

Confirmed

Total Received95.21682629 DCR
Total Sent0 DCR
Final Balance95.21682629 DCR
No. Transactions1

Transactions

DsV7fvGu7GyqYUT2jPNACpW6vMb9qom9yBy75.18148136 DCR
No Inputs (Newly Generated Coins)
DsmaFakf4QRxwzPSuhKdrV9vzw8VbjaScmV95.21682629 DCR ×
DsaJVE7se3XE4xNtQ82k1hNumrdeJ8c4ZZY76.93392188 DCR
Fee: 0 DCR
635368 Confirmations172.15074817 DCR